F1 Dutch GP – Start time, how to watch, starting grid & TV channel

McLaren driver Lando Norris will start the race from pole position after beating home favourite and Red Bull rival Max Verstappen by over three tenths of a second in qualifying. 

Their team-mates, Oscar Piastri and Sergio Perez respectively, qualified third and fifth in that order, separated by the Mercedes of George Russell.

Carlos Sainz (Ferrari) and Lewis Hamilton (Mercedes) will line up 11th and 12th on the grid after both failed to progress to Q3.

What time does the Dutch Grand Prix start?

The Dutch GP will begin at 3pm local time (+2 GMT) at Circuit Zandvoort.

Date: Sunday, 25 August, 2024 Start time: 13:00 GMT  / 14:00 BST / 15:00 CEST  / 15:00 SAT / 16:00 EAT  / 09:00 ET / 06:00 PT / 23:00 AEST / 22:00 JST / 18:30 IST 2024 Formula 1 Dutch Grand Prix session timings in different timezones

How can I watch the Dutch Grand Prix?

Formula 1 is broadcast live in nearly every country around the world. 

Europe

Austria - Servus TV / ORF Belgium - RTBF / Telenet / Play Sports Croatia - Sport Klub Czech Republic - AMC Denmark - TV3+ / TV3 Sport / Viaplay Estonia: Viaplay Finland - Viaplay  France - Canal+ Germany - Sky  Greece - ANT1 / ANT1+ Hungary - M4 Italy - Sky Netherlands - Viaplay / Viaplay Xtra Norway - V sport 1 / V sport + / Viaplay Poland - Viaplay Portugal - Sport TV Spain - F1 DAZN Sweden - Viaplay / V sport motor / TV 10 Switzerland - SRF / RSI / RTS UK - Sky Sports F1

Americas

USA - ESPN Canada - RDS / RDS2 / TSN / Noovo Latin America - ESPN

Asia

China - CCTV / Shanghai TV / Guangdong Television Channel / Tencent India - FanCode Japan - Fuji TV / DAZN Malaysia - beIN SPORTS Indonesia- beIN SPORTS Singapore - beIN SPORTS Thailand - beIN SPORTS Vietnam - K+

Oceania

Australia - Fox Sports / Foxtel / Kayo / Network Ten New Zealand - Sky

Africa

Africa - SuperSport Can I stream the F1 Dutch Grand Prix?

Viewers can subscribe to F1 TV in selected countries to stream the race on a device of their choice.

Sky Sports and Movistar also offer their own live streaming service in the UK and Spain respectively.
